Njoki Murira Recovers TikTok Account With Over 2 Million Followers

Kenyan TikTok sensation Njoki Murira has regained access to her account after it was mysteriously banned. The social media star, who boasts over 2 million followers, shared the good news with her fans on multiple platforms.

Earlier this week, Murira had expressed her dismay over the sudden ban, urging her supporters to follow her on a newly created account. Her fans responded with an outpouring of support, taking to other social media outlets to voice their frustration and demand transparency from the short-form video platform.

The hashtag #BringBackNjoki quickly gained momentum, with users flooding social media with their favorite Murira moments and calls for her account’s reinstatement. TikTok, in response to the public outcry, issued a brief statement acknowledging the concerns raised by the community. The platform assured users that it was actively investigating the matter and would take appropriate action based on its findings.

Murira, known for her engaging and diverse content, has captivated TikTok audiences with her entertaining dance routines, informative videos, and glimpses into her life in the village. Her popularity skyrocketed after she shared videos showcasing her enviable physique, and last year, she revealed that she had amassed a staggering Ksh3.4 million (approximately US$27,000) through the platform, primarily from live sessions and fan-sent gifts.
